system.out.println((foreach)学生信息:); for (object obj:students) { student s=(student) obj; system.out.println(编号: + s.id + \t\t\t姓名: + s.name + \t\t\t年龄: + s.age + \t\t\t性别: + s.gender); } }
从代码上来看,foreach 语句显然比 for 循环语句简洁明了了许多,不需要定义初始值,也不需要确定判断范围,同时也不用进行递增递减。但这些并不能代表,foreach 语句就能代替 for 循环语句,显然 foreach 能做的,for循环都可以做;for 循环能做的,foreach 却不一定可以做。
以上就是java中如何foreach语句使用遍历所有元素的详细内容。
